Europe is splintered.

Its political leaders are as rudderless and directionless as ever.

Ever since Angela Merkel departed the stage, we have seen the European Union operate with less confidence and a clarity of purpose.

While Poland may have ditched its populist leader for someone with a bit of gravitas and sense, much of the continent is headed in the opposite direction, with Italy, The Netherlands, Austria, Hungary plumbing for players, who would have thrived in the 1930s.

To Vladimir Vladimirovich Putin, who has designs on the wider continent, these developments couldn’t have come at a better time.

Despite rhetoric to contrary, in his interviews with Tucker Carlson and other players, in which he talked up the incumbent at 1600 Pennsylvania Avenue as being the preferred candidate for Russia and Russians, having Donald Trump in the White House, will bring him several steps closer to actualizing his dreams.

Biden knows this and so do the Republican political leadership in Congress and Senate.
